Book Review: Merle’s Door: Lessons from a Freethinking Dog

Mommy couldn’t put this book down.  She said that it was not only a wonderful story but very educational. Merle’s Door: Lessons from a Freethinking Dog  is a story about a 10 month old puppy that finds his new owner in the middle of the Utah wilderness.  The two bond and enjoy a 13 year life of freedom, adventure,  fun and lessons learned.   They go hunting, skiing and on other adventures together but Merle also has many adventures on his own.
